    “Australia’s energy market operator should be split in two and the national transmission network brought back under a public ownership model, according to a new report that is calling for a “fundamental overhaul” of the National Electricity Market.
    The analysis, published this week by The Australia Institute, is authored by University of Queensland economics professor John Quiggin, a long-time critic of the National Electricity Market (NEM) for – as he put it almost 10 years ago in 2017 – consistently failing to achieve its purpose.” (Source: reneweconomy.com.au/aemo-shoul )
